TEHRAN (Tasnim) - Iran has started preparations for the second leg of the 2018 AFC Champions League final between Persepolis and Japan's Kashima Antlers on November 10.

It will be Persepolis FC's first AFC Champions League final and a meeting to discuss the organization of the second leg at the Azadi Stadium was held at the Sports and Youth Ministry on Saturday, the-afc.com wrote.

Mehdi Taj, the President of the Football Federation Islamic Republic of Iran, representatives of the Development and Equipment Company, Tehran Prosecutor, Customs and various other agencies attended the meeting.

Discussions were centered on ensuring the smooth flow of the second leg of the final, which several hundred international delegates and guests are expected to attend.

Both teams will be playing in the AFC Champions League final for the first time, with Kashima Antlers hosting the first leg on November 3.

The Japanese side edged Korea Republic's Suwon Samsung Bluewings 6-5 on aggregate in the semi-finals while Persepolis ended the challenge of Qatar's Al Sadd, winning the two-leg clash 2-1 on aggregate.
